Transaction 75fd668dca9485784eb75cb93679e10a64f1a1335a98e1edfd18dc2e3013e8e4

2 Input
1 Outputs
  • 75fd668dca9485784eb75cb93679e10a64f1a1335a98e1edfd18dc2e3013e8e4:0
  • value  2734288
    address  3MBPyTsiPX64xWBwL4A5eGZyUwggNQrHRt